ERPA is a client-centered technology services firm, modernizing and maximizing customer’s investment in Workday. Our team delivers holistic solutions for customers looking to maximize their Workday investment and elevate the user experience by offering Phase 1 implementations, on-going application management services, Phase X and follow-on solutions, analytics, and overall optimization.  

 

Position Summary: 

 

As the Workday Financials Architect, you will not only play an active role in client engagement, but also serve as the subject matter expert for Workday Financials implementations for higher ed customers. Additionally, you will help existing Workday Financials customers expand their usage of the product and optimize their existing processes.  You should showcase innovation, strategic thinking and have the drive to make ERPA a Workday partner of choice. 

 

Key Responsibilities: 

  • Act as a lead consultant on multiple client engagements with limited direction 

  • Understand client business requirements and provide guidance throughout design, configuration and prototype, and assist clients with testing and move to production efforts 

  • Partner with Engagement Managers to keep them informed of project status, changes, etc. 

  • Collaborate with cross-functional counterparts to ensure clear lines of communication and project alignment 

  • Accurately maintain forecast in a timely manner 

  • Partner with the Sales team and serve as a Subject Matter Expert while assisting with sales presentations, demos, and LOEs 

  • Stay up to date on industry knowledge, Workday enhancements, and be able to advise on Workday best practices 

  • Build strong relationships with clients, gained through trust and exceptional customer service  

Experience & Education Requirements: 

  • Experience leading multiple higher ed Workday Financials implementations is required. 

  • 5+ years of experience designing and configuring Workday Financials solutions for multiple customers is required. 

  • 4+ years of experience as a Workday Financials lead consultant at a partner firm is required.  

  • Workday Partner certification in Workday Financials is required and must remain in Active status throughout employment with ERPA 

  • Must be able to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ines.  

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ills are required, along with a detailed understanding of WorkdayFinancials processes and best practices to make appropriate implementation recommendations.  

  • Demonstrated ability to work independently as well as in a team environment, coupled with a desire to have fun while building something new (required)

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
